Study of α Chain States through Their Decay Widths

Abstract:
The structure of the peculiar excited levels in 12C and 16O are investigated by analysing the decay widths of these levels which have been usually assumed to have the linear chainlike structure of the α particles. In the analyses of the decay widths all the two body breakup channels are taken into considerations. The theoretical calculations of the reduced width ampliutudes are done by using the Bloch-Brink type wave functions. For 12C, the comparison between the theory and experiments showed that the pure linear chain configuration is inappropriate to explain the large experimental widths. On the other hand, for 16O, the present experimental informations on widths are understood not to be inconsistent with the assumption of the linear chain structure.
